Lockstock Festival
The lockstock festival was created in 2008 as a multistage one night event that aimed to provide a platform for new talented artists, acts, musicians and performers to come together and celebrate at the cultural epicenter of alternative art, music and culture in the capital – Camden Lock Market.
Over the last year the event has grown to include a comedy stage, outdoor art exhibition, street performances and has and always will endeavor to break boundaries with creative thought and innovative ideas.
Based in Camden Lock market and the surrounding venues (Dingwalls, Lock 17, the Lockside Lounge and the Yumchaa Tea Shop) The festival has already provided a chance for lots of emerging artists and acts. There aren’t many places you can see so many talented musicians and artists for free in one day.

DIE! DIE! DIE!
Die! Die! Die! are a punk three-piece from New Zealand formed in late 2003. Their music has been described as being abrasive, noisy and rough with a strong emphasis on the rhythm section within the band. The band are renowned for incessantly touring internationally since they began, focusing their efforts in New Zealand, Australia, the UK and USA (especially New York), and brief travels through Europe. The band’s live shows have become infamous for their energy and front man Andrew Wilson’s tendency to use the entire venue, climbing and writhing around the audience, with microphone in hand.
LITTLANS:
As befits a band who’s had a U.K. hit dueting with Peter Doherty (on the sublime single “Their Way”), Littl’ans is no stranger to chaos. Its last British tour saw gigs canceled thanks to, amongst other things, an exploding gas canister and a double booking with 80s legend Echo and the Bunnymen. When it supported Babyshambles, it was subjected to the indignities of the rubber glove treatment after the bus it was travelling on was raided for drugs by the police. (The band was later released without charges.) Yet, Littl’ans, whose name is Cockney vernacular meaning “Little Ones,” soldiers on gallantly. After all, in rock and roll the chaos is part of the deal. Four in number - singer and guitarist Andrew Aveling, drummer Ben Clarke, guitarist Alex Mahood and bassist Ryan Blagrove. These days, Littl’ans erractically traverses the country playing doo-wop-influenced pop with the dazed, dark charm of a Syd Barrett or a Nick Drake. It’s suprisingly delicate music for such a hard-living band - but then romance often exists in squalor.”
words by Alex Needham, deputy editor at NME magazine,

The Illersapiens
The Illersapiens are a 7 piece hip hop collective from South London. The band Promote positivity and freedom of speech, which is reflected in the crowds they attract and the energy of their live performances.
Growing up in south London the Illersapiens style has evolved from a colourful hybrid of music from Reggae to Broken beat, drawing inspiration from Hip Hop acts such as A Tribe called quest, MF Doom, Wu Tang Clan, The Roots, J Dilla, Flying Lotus and Madlib.
The Band’s energy and passion for the music shines through in their performances and are one to watch in the future.
Their debut E.P, self titled ‘The Illersapiens’ received high critical acclaim and is still in high demand.

London Soul
London Soul, a multi-award winning dynamic 12-piece Soul/ Funk/ Rhythm band that have played every major venue and have been established at the top of their trade for many years.
Comprising a full brass section London Soul play an excellent dancing repertoire guaranteed to keep your feet moving.
Originally formed in 1997, London Soul are one of the highest respected show bands having performed at major international venues all across the globe appearing at coveted events such as international award ceremonies and major global corporation functions.
Rave reviews of London Soul performances include that published by ‘The Stage and Television’ national entertainment newspaper;
“This 12-piece soul band blew a storm to start the second half. How rewarding to see so many talented young people playing real instruments, superbly attired and exceptional visually. The four vocalists featured a great span of songs from Aretha Franklin to Jailhouse Rock… Simply phenomenal.”
